Identifying Risks Before They Cost You

One of the most common mistakes investors make is underestimating the potential challenges that a piece of land may hold. Boundaries that are unclear, easements that restrict construction, or zoning conflicts can all lead to delays and unexpected costs. Without the guidance of professional land surveyors in Edmonton, these issues might not come to light until construction is already underway.

A comprehensive land survey exposes these risks early. By identifying potential problems ahead of time, developers can adjust their plans, renegotiate contracts, or even decide to walk away from a deal that poses too many risks. This proactive step can save both money and stress in the long run.

Maximizing the Potential of the Land

A land survey does more than reveal problems—it also highlights opportunities. Accurate topographic surveys, for example, provide critical information about the land’s elevation and features. With this knowledge, developers can design structures that take advantage of natural slopes, drainage, and layout, ultimately making better use of the property.

Professional land surveyors in Edmonton also ensure that boundaries are clearly established, which can open up options for subdividing land, maximizing lot usage, or planning future expansions. By knowing exactly what is possible within the property lines, developers can make smarter decisions that increase the property’s long-term profitability.

Supporting Legal Protection and Future Resale Value

Disputes over property boundaries and encroachments are not uncommon in real estate. A professional land survey provides a legal safeguard by documenting the exact limits of ownership. This documentation is crucial not only during development but also for resale value. Future buyers and lenders will see the survey as proof of clarity and legitimacy, making the property more attractive in the market.

For developers aiming to turn a profit on their projects, having this level of legal protection is not just a formality—it’s a strategic advantage. It reduces liability, strengthens negotiation positions, and adds long-term value to the investment.
